Dhaka: Six people died of dengue, and 1,492 were hospitalised after being infected with dengue in the last 24 hours till 8:00 am today, according to a regular report of the Directorate General of Health Services (DGHS).
According to Bangladesh Sangbad Sangstha, of the new hospitalised dengue patients, 559 were in Dhaka Division, 80 in Mymensingh Division, 202 in Chattogram Division, 284 in Khulna Division, 178 in Barishal Division, 54 in Rangpur Division, 122 in Rajshahi Division, and 13 in Sylhet Division.
The report indicates that a total of 48,430 dengue patients have been hospitalised across the country this year. With the six deaths in the past 24 hours, the total death toll from the disease has reached 139 this year.
In the last 24 hours, 1,304 patients recovered and were discharged from hospitals. This year, a total of 44,857 dengue patients have recovered and returned home after receiving treatment in hospitals.
Last year, a total of 102,861 people were infected with dengue, and 413 people died from the disease.
